The fireplace surround refers to the jacket placed on the peripheral sides of the fireplace. These are available in almost every form and size. They also resemble to a certain extent to the fire place mantels. Those stores dealing in accessories and equipments related to fireplaces, generally house fireplace surrounds. The customers can choose from a wide range of styles as well as finishes when it comes to Antique fireplace surrounds.
The only consideration to be made is the budget and the taste of the customer. The consumer is expected to make some queries with regard to the kind of materials employed in the construction of the Fireplace Surround. Its longevity is also a major concern. A lot depends on the customer’s preferences and order of the looks and type of building materials. Stone, wood, glass or tiles may be chosen from among the building materials. Oak is often used as a common material in building fireplace surrounds to bring in that ancient feel. Art Deco style of design was popular in the 1920s and 1930s; marked by stylized forms and geometric designs adapted to mass production. It is an eclectic artistic and design style which had its origins in Paris in the first decades of the 20th century. The term Art Deco is used to describe stylistic changes that occurred to nearly every visual medium in the interwar years and for a number of years before and after and the fascination still continues. The style, which was universal, represents a move away from traditional values and was characterised by clean, geometric and elegant lines that replaced the excessive decoration of previous styles.
